- [ ] Payroll export format change (Tallygrove v9). CSV export drops the legacy `period_code` column; replaced by `cycle_ref`. Plugin authors: update parsers before the cutover window or exports will fail validation. Old format remains readable for one release, write support removed entirely. Test against the staging endpoint using sample files in the compatibility pack. No schema negotiation — the format is detected per file. Verify your plugin against the certified build listed directly below.

build token for kagaf-hahof: htk14_9d3d4d26d7d8de

**Day One — Fire-Drill Roll Call**

Quick one for team assistants at Larkspur House: make sure your new starter is added to the floor warden's roll-call sheet before lunch, otherwise they won't be counted at the muster point. Walk them to Assembly Point B by the courtyard so they know the route. To get back in through the courtyard door afterwards, use the code below.

turnstile pass: bdg-FVNQRS-72965873

Reviewer context: render workers are CPU-bound on large documents with heavy table syntax. Current fleet handles peak traffic at roughly 70% utilization, leaving thin headroom for the upcoming docs migration. Plan: add two workers per zone, cap per-document render time, and shunt oversized inputs to the async queue instead of blocking the hot path. Cache hit rate should absorb most repeat renders, so the async queue stays shallow.

The proposed caps and pool sizes are captured in the constants below.

tuning table, faweg-bajep:
WEIGHTS = {
    "belius": 690,
    "eliox": 458,
    "norax": 616,
    "praion": 132,
    "zorvan": 911,
}